Tree of Life Presents a Night of Music with Forrest and Cassandra
Tree of Life Unitarian Universalist Congregation, will present "A Night of Music with Forrest and Cassandra" Saturday, April 27, 7-9 pm.
Tree of Life Unitarian Universalist Congregation, 5603 Bull Valley Road in McHenry, will present a unique “Night of Music with Forrest and Cassandra” on Saturday, April 27 from 7 to 10 pm.
Forrest Ransburg, the Musical Director at Tree of Life, will perform a selection of flute works ranging from the Baroque era on instruments of the time to modern works involving unexpected sounds generated by a variety of electronic media.
Cassandra Vohs-Demann, singer and songwriter, popular performer in McHenry County venues and Woodstock Community Choir Director will perform a set of her original compositions and share the personal experiences that inspired them.
